linux 如何删除 脚本

linux 如何删除 脚本,第1张

运行这个命令

crontab -e

此命令将打开一个文本编辑器以添加新任务。

* 20 * * * rm -rf /root/febhost/dat/* /root/febhost/log/*

用对应的文本编辑器命令保存退出(vi编辑器是按esc后打:wq)

如果你对这种方式不熟悉,也可以直接改/etc/crontab,我看到你是要删除root文件夹内的目录,假设你有root权限(因为/etc/crontab所有者是root,并且只有以root身份执行删除命令才能删除root home内的文件),用以下命令打开此文件:

vi /etc/crontab

将光标移动至最后一行,按o键新开一行输入以下内容:

* 20 * * * root rm -rf /root/febhost/dat/* /root/febhost/log/* 更多Linux知识可参考书籍《Linux就该这么学》。

看你用什么方式安装的 用rpm包的话可以用 ”rpm -e 包名“ 来删 用deb包,可以用 "dpkg -r "或"dpkg -P" 加 包名 来删除 如果用的源码方式(tar.gz等 )真找到你安装的目录将文件删除 如果你安了x window 用相应的软件来管理吧

给你个思路,不懂问我,如果想要我帮你写出来,你可以加点分啊

查找半年的文件可以用find命令

find 的-mtime 按更改时间 find . -mtime -5 -print -表示在5天之内更改过的 find . -mtime +5 -print +表示在5天之前更改过的

每周日删除可以用到cronta(具体使用方法请百度)

无法是每个周日脚本运行一次,cd到指定文件夹,利用find命令找到对应的文件删除就ok了


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/7681097.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-08
下一篇 2023-04-08

发表评论

登录后才能评论

评论列表(0条)

保存